Foreign Body Aspirations in Childhood
GATA Çocuk Cerrahisi Anabilim Dalı
Foreign body aspiration is a common pediatric emergency
in childhood. It has a high mortality rate in the
first three years of life. The aim of the study was to
evaluate the patients performed bronchoscopy for
suspicion of foreign body aspiration between 1995
and 2003, retrospectively. The rigid bronchoscopies
were done in 15 patients and foreign bodies were
defined and removed in 13 patients. During or just
after the bronchoscopy, a total of 3 complications
were detected (bronchospasm in two patients, cardiac
arrest in one patient) but no patient was
deceased. Foreign body aspirations could have similar
clinical findings with other pediatric pulmonary
problems in childhood. Therefore the patients who
have suspicion of foreign body aspiration should be
evaluated promptly and systematically and treated as
soon as possible.
